The Baiterek Tower

Opening Hours: Open from 9:00am-9:00pm

Ticket Price: 700 KZT

Recommended Length of Stay: 1-2 Hours

Location: Vodno-Zelyony Blvd 1 | Turkestana and Dostyk Streets Corner, Astana 010000, Kazakhstan

The Bayterek Observation Tower in Astana, the capital, is a symbol of the city. This memorial tower and observation tower is inspired by the Kazakh mythology. The story tells of a mysterious tree of life and a blissful magic bird that lays an egg between the branches of the tree every year.

Presidential Center of Culture of Kazakhstan

Ticket Price: Free

Recommended Length of Stay: 1.0-2.0 Hours

Location: Respublika Ave 2, Nur-Sultan 010000 Kazakhstan

For the new city of Astana, the cultural center is a nice public building and an important museum for the city. The cultural center is located on the east side of the river, at the junction of AleksandrBarayev Street and Zhumabek Tashenov Street. On the first floor of the center, tapestries, costumes, harnesses, etc. are displayed; on the second floor, you can visit some cultural relics, as well as models of old buildings across the country ; On the third floor, you can learn about the history of Kazakhstan since the 14th century, and there are English explanations.

Hazret Sultan Mosque

Opening Hours: Open 24 hours

Recommended Length of Stay: 1-2 Hours

Location: Tauelsizdik Ave 48, Astana 010000, Kazakhstan

The "Hazrat Sultan" Mosque is the largest mosque in Kazakhstan and the largest mosque in the entire Asian region except West Asia. It can accommodate 5,000 to 10,000 people indoors and outdoors. The overall color of the mosque is white, and in the afterglow of the Central Asian prairie, it emits a cold light. The young "Hazrat Sultan" mosque also has its own treasure.

Franfromivegill: This is known as Khan Shatyr. It is listed as an “Entertainment Centre”. Typically of countries with extreme weather, it is a shopping centre with benefits. Free cloakrooms are widely used since internal temperature is kept between 20-25 degrees C. The basement carpark hosts a few little shops for key-cutting, shoe repairs, flowers, dry cleaning. The basement shopping area has more functional shops like housewares, electrical, stationary, sports and a good-quality supermarket selling foreign food as well as local. There is also a Currency Exchange kiosk. Floors 1 and 2 are crammed with a variety of shops - mainly clothes - often big international brands. Small kiosks are dotted selling tourist bits including traditional Kazak jewellry. There is usually home-grown entertainment - think kareoke/Kazakhstan has talent - often children performing. The centre is designed as a huge traditional tent and is in a line visible from the Presidential Palace. Upper stories have entertainments eg children’s fun fare, cinema and a beach ( though I did not vidit that!!). There are a few restaurants but food here is mainly branded fast food eg BurgerKing, McDonalds - all on the upper fllors - most on floor 3. Always a fun place to go shopping.
